Bastille Day commemorations in Portland, Oregon, constitute an annual celebration of French culture and the historical event of the storming of the Bastille. These events often feature elements such as French cuisine, music, and entertainment, designed to foster an appreciation for French heritage within the local community.

Observances contribute to cultural diversity and provide educational opportunities for residents to learn about French history and traditions. Such gatherings promote community engagement and enhance Portland’s reputation as a city that values and celebrates its multicultural population. The historical context of the Bastille, a symbol of the French Revolution, lends significance to these local celebrations.

  • French Restaurants and Bakeries

    French-themed establishments are key participants. They often create special menus, offer discounts, and host events to coincide with Bastille Day. For example, a local French restaurant might offer a prix fixe menu featuring classic dishes like bouillabaisse or steak frites. Bakeries may create Bastille Day-themed pastries such as flag-colored macarons or miniature Eiffel Tower cakes. These culinary offerings provide attendees with an authentic taste of French culture while driving business for these establishments.

  • Retail Businesses with French Connections

    Retailers selling French products, such as wines, cheeses, or perfumes, also participate. They may offer promotions, host tasting events, or create themed displays. For instance, a wine shop might feature a selection of wines from different regions of France, offering tastings and educational information. These activities not only boost sales but also contribute to the educational aspect of the celebration by showcasing French goods and traditions.

  • Local Craft Vendors

    Craft vendors producing goods with a French theme may set up booths at Bastille Day events, offering items such as French-inspired art, jewelry, or clothing. This participation adds a diverse range of products to the celebration and provides opportunities for local artisans to showcase their talents. For instance, an artist might sell paintings of Parisian scenes or a clothing designer might offer berets or striped shirts. These vendors contribute to the vibrant atmosphere of the event and support the local economy.

  • Regional Specialties

    Bastille Day Portland frequently showcases the diverse regional cuisines of France. From crpes and galettes representing Brittany to bouillabaisse symbolizing Provence, the event provides a culinary tour of France. The inclusion of these dishes offers attendees an opportunity to explore the varied flavors and culinary techniques that define French gastronomy. This promotes a deeper appreciation for the country’s cultural heritage.

  • Pastries and Desserts

    French pastries and desserts, renowned for their intricate preparation and delicate flavors, are prominently featured. Macarons, clairs, and madeleines are commonly available, providing a sweet counterpoint to the savory offerings. These desserts, often visually appealing and meticulously crafted, serve as both a culinary delight and a representation of French artistry. Their presence contributes to the festive atmosphere and encourages attendees to indulge in traditional French treats.

  • Wine and Cheese Pairings

    Wine and cheese, integral elements of French dining, are often incorporated into Bastille Day Portland. Wine tastings featuring selections from various French regions may be offered, paired with artisanal cheeses. This allows attendees to experience the complementary flavors of French wine and cheese and to learn about the history and production of these iconic products. The inclusion of wine and cheese pairings adds a sophisticated dimension to the culinary experience.
